Posted 28.06.10
LANGLAND DOMINATES IPA BEST OF HEALTH AWARDS, SCOOPING 50 OUT OF 119 AWARDS
Langland's award success changed up a gear at the recent IPA Best of Health Awards, announced in London on 24 June.
The agency walked away with almost half of all awards presented, including Best of Show Healthcare Professional for its client Napp's BuTrans brand. On the night, Langland received no less than 16 Silver and 32 Bronze awards across a portfolio of ten individual clients, with Bayer HealthCare's Kogenate brand singled out for Best Use of Art Direction. This incredible performance surpassed even last year's record-breaking tally of 29 awards, which also included the Best of Show.

Posted 07.06.10
LANGLAND BREAKS NOVOCURE STORY EXCLUSIVELY WITH ITN NEWS
In a meeting arranged with ITN's Medical Editor, Langland secured agreement to develop a news item centered on NovoCure's portable medical device, NovoTTF-100A.
NovoCure is a pioneering oncology company developing technology for treating solid tumours with very encouraging results. Langland and the ITN team travelled to Ireland to interview a patient currently receiving treatment, whilst a second unit filmed the product's inventor in Haifa, Israel. A total of 3.59 million people tuned in to watch this fascinating bulletin, helping raise our client's profile and driving interest from news agencies further afield.

Posted 01.02.10
LANGLAND SETS RECORD AT PM AWARDS
Langland has dominated the 2009 PM Society Advertising Awards, taking an incredible seven of 17 categories, the best performance ever by a single agency.
During the ceremony, held at the Grosvenor House hotel on 29 January, Langland's work was recognised a total of 17 times, with 3 finalists, 3 highly commended, and 4 commended, alongside the seven winners.
Neil G P Smith, the Awards' chairman, singled us out for congratulations, saying: "The distinctive style of their work clearly found much favour with our creative judges."
Among the winning work, our Compass campaign for Schering-Plough was particularly successful, taking first place in the hospital campaign, journal advertisement campaign and hospital journal advertisement categories. Our work for Eisai Europe and UK on NeuroBloc, a treatment cervical dystonia, was also a multiple winner, for best core international campaign and best detail aid.
Langland's 'Real Danger - Rat' continued its prolonged run of form, appearing in a bucket of popcorn to help us win the award for best healthcare industry journal advertisement.

Posted 27.11.09
LANGLAND BAGS TWO AT
EFFECTIVENESS AWARDSLangland has taken two wins at the 2009 Pharmaceutical Marketing Effectiveness Awards, held on 26 November at the Hilton hotel, Park Lane.
Our campaign 'Compass: Clear direction in the management of hepatitis C', produced for Schering-Plough, won the Healthcare Collaboration Award, and we also took top honours with Product Launch of the Year, for AstraZeneca's Seroquel XL.
Two other Langland entries were finalists in their categories: our work for AstraZeneca's Psychiatry Live event was rewarded in the Customer Focus section, and 'Get Real, Get a Prescription', our multimedia counterfeit medicine awareness campaign with Pfizer, reached the final in Public Health Marketing.
